Produced by Altadis U.S.A, the original Dominican Romeo Julieta 1875 boasts fully aged blend of Brazilian and Dominican long filler tobacco, finished with a Dominican binder and stunning, oily, Indonesian Shade Grown TBN java wrapper.

Romeo y Julieta cigars have been celebrated as one of the first names in premium cigars, both Cuban and otherwise, on heritage alone. Launched in 1875 and named for the leads in Shakespeare’s epic tragedy, Romeo and Juliet went on to win a slew of tasting awards at worldwide cigar exhibitions within just a few years of their debut.
